Allyltriethylsilane is widely utilized in research focused on various practical applications:
- Synthesis of Organosilicon Compounds: It serves as a versatile reagent in the synthesis of organosilicon compounds, which are essential in the production of silicone materials used in sealants, adhesives, and coatings.
- Polymer Chemistry: This compound is employed in polymerization processes, particularly in the creation of specialty polymers that exhibit enhanced thermal and chemical resistance, making them ideal for automotive and aerospace applications.
- Organic Synthesis: Researchers leverage its unique reactivity in organic synthesis to create complex molecules, aiding in drug discovery and development by providing pathways to new pharmaceuticals.
- Surface Modification: It is used in surface modification techniques to improve the adhesion properties of materials, which is crucial in industries like electronics and packaging.
- Cross-Coupling Reactions: Allyltriethylsilane plays a significant role in cross-coupling reactions, allowing for the formation of carbon-carbon bonds, which is vital in the synthesis of fine chemicals and agrochemicals.
